If r is the radius of the base and h be the height of a cylinder, then its volume is (………….) cubic units.

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To find the volume of a cylinder given the radius of the base (r) and the height (h), we can follow these steps: 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Identify the Formula for Volume of a Cylinder**: The volume (V) of a cylinder can be calculated using the formula: \[ V = \text{Area of the base} \times \text{Height} \] 2. **Determine the Area of the Base**: The base of the cylinder is a circle. The area (A) of a circle is given by the formula: \[ A = \pi r^2 \] where \( \pi \) (Pi) is a constant approximately equal to 3.14, and \( r \) is the radius of the circle. 3. **Substitute the Area into the Volume Formula**: Now, we substitute the area of the base into the volume formula: \[ V = \pi r^2 \times h \] 4. **Write the Final Expression for Volume**: Thus, the volume of the cylinder can be expressed as: \[ V = \pi r^2 h \] This represents the volume in cubic units. ### Final Answer: The volume of the cylinder is \( \pi r^2 h \) cubic units. ---
